Abstract:
The authors’ review presents original methodical development works and integrates the research on the modeling of processes and estimation of physicochemical characteristics of natural (hydrocarbons) and chemical (energetic materials) energy sources. A fundamentally new method of energy generation based on transition of excited helium atoms to the superstable state in superstrong magnetic fields is described. A hypothetical possibility for these states to exist was predicted by one of the authors and confirmed by calculations.
